Defensive Tackle – Miller’s Top 5

  1. peter Woods (Clemson)
  2. Tim Keenan III (Alabama)
  3. Keanu Tanuvasa (BYU)
  4. Lee Hunter (Texas Tech)
  5. Zane Durant (Penn State)

Defensive Tackle – reid’s Top 5

  1. Peter Woods (Clemson)
  2. Caleb Banks (Florida)
  3. Christen Miller (Georgia)
  4. Zane Durant (Penn State)
  5. Tim Keenan III (Alabama)

Toughest Player to Rank (Reid): Caleb Banks (Florida).Finished season on a hot streak, with 3.5 sacks in his final two games.

  1. Anthony Hill Jr. (Texas)
  2. CJ Allen (Georgia)
  3. Deontae Lawson (Alabama)
  4. Whit Weeks (LSU)
  5. Harold Perkins Jr. (LSU)

Linebacker – Reid’s Top 5

  1. Anthony Hill Jr.(Texas)
  2. CJ Allen (Georgia)
  3. Whit weeks (LSU)
  4. Deontae Lawson (Alabama)
  5. Sonny Styles (Ohio State)

Toughest Player to Rank (Miller): Harold Perkins (LSU). Dual-threat, but missed the final nine games of 2024 after suffering torn ACL.
* Player Outside the Top 5 to Watch (Reid): Suntarine Perkins (Ole Miss). 10.5 sacks last season.
